Web design vs. web development

I get asked this from time to time. In the minds of many, web design and web development might seem like interchangeable terms. While both fields require a unique set of skills and expertise, they serve different purposes, and understanding their differences is crucial for anyone looking to build a successful website. In this blog, we’ll explore the distinctions between web design and web development, shedding light on their unique roles in the digital landscape.

Web Design: Crafting the Visual Aesthetic

Web design focuses primarily on the visual aspects of a website, such as its layout, color scheme, typography, and images. The main goal of a web designer is to create a user interface (UI) that is not only aesthetically pleasing but also intuitive and easy to navigate. Web designers use various design principles and tools to achieve a seamless balance between form and function.

The design process typically starts with wireframing and prototyping, where the designer maps out the website’s structure, followed by creating mockups that represent the final look and feel of the site. Web designers utilize tools like Adobe Photoshop, Illustrator, and Sketch to craft the visual elements and collaborate with web developers to bring their designs to life on the web.

Web Development: Bringing Designs to Life

Web development, on the other hand, is the process of converting a visual design into a fully functional website. It involves writing code that dictates the site’s behavior, interactions, and functionality. Web developers are responsible for translating the web designer’s vision into reality, ensuring that the website operates smoothly and efficiently across various devices and browsers.

Web development can be further divided into two categories: front-end and back-end development. Front-end developers work on the client side, using HTML, CSS, and JavaScript to build the site’s interface and interactive elements. They transform the web designer’s static mockups into dynamic, responsive web pages.

Back-end developers focus on server-side operations, such as managing databases and developing the logic behind the site’s functionality. They work with programming languages like PHP, Python, Ruby, and Java, and employ frameworks and content management systems (CMS) to create a seamless user experience.

The Intersection of Design and Development

Though web design and web development are distinct disciplines, there is often overlap between the two. In recent years, the line between design and development has become increasingly blurred as professionals in both fields expand their skill sets into full-stack website development. For example, a front-end developer might learn design principles to improve the visual appeal of their code, while a web designer could learn basic HTML and CSS to better communicate with developers.

In summary, web design and web development are two distinct yet interconnected fields that work together to create beautiful, functional websites. While web designers focus on the visual aspects and user experience, web developers bring those designs to life with their technical expertise. By understanding the differences between these disciplines and the value they bring to the table, you can make more informed decisions when building a website or pursuing a career in the digital world.

Skip to content